December 2023 – Convocation The Bill and Sandra Pomeroy College of Nursing at Crouse Hospital held its December 2023 Convocation Ceremony on Friday, December 15 at the DoubleTree Hotel in East Syracuse. 43 graduate nurses received diplomas. Syracuse, NY – Crouse Hospital’s Addiction Treatment Services (ATS), the largest hospital-based addiction treatment program in Central New York, has received a grant of $100,000 from the Mother Cabrini Health Foundation. Meet Certified Nurse Midwife Mary Thompson. Born in South America and educated in England, Mary is a medical pioneer in Central New York, having been among just a handful of midwives in Syracuse during the early 1980s.
